2.2. Argo CD 사용자 정의 리소스 속성


Argo CD 사용자 정의 리소스는 다음 속성으로 구성됩니다.

Expand

이름

설명

Default

속성

ApplicationInstanceLabelKey

Argo CD가 앱 이름을 추적 레이블로 삽입하는 metadata.label 키 이름입니다.

app.kubernetes.io/instance

 

ApplicationSet

ApplicationSet 컨트롤러 구성 옵션

<Object>

  • &lt ; image> - ApplicationSet 컨트롤러의 컨테이너 이미지입니다. 이렇게 하면 ARGOCD_APPLICATIONSET_IMAGE 환경 변수가 재정의됩니다.
  • &lt ; version> - ApplicationSet 컨테이너 이미지와 함께 사용할 태그입니다.
  • < resources > - 컨테이너 컴퓨팅 리소스입니다.
  • &lt ;loglevel> - Argo CD 애플리케이션 컨트롤러 구성 요소에서 사용하는 로그 수준입니다. 유효한 옵션은 debug,info,error, warn 입니다.
  • < LogFormat > - Argo CD 애플리케이션 컨트롤러 구성 요소에서 사용하는 로그 형식입니다. 유효한 옵션은 text 또는 json 입니다.
  • <PrallelismLimit > - 컨트롤러에 설정할 kubectl 병렬 처리 제한 (--kubectl-parallelism-limit 플래그) 입니다.

ConfigManagementPlugins

구성 관리 플러그인을 추가합니다.

<empty>

 

컨트롤러

Argo CD 애플리케이션 컨트롤러 옵션.

<Object>

  • <processors.Operation > - 작업 프로세서 수입니다.
  • <processors.Status > - 상태 프로세서 수입니다.
  • < resources > - 컨테이너 컴퓨팅 리소스입니다.
  • &lt ;loglevel> - Argo CD 애플리케이션 컨트롤러 구성 요소에서 사용하는 로그 수준입니다. 유효한 옵션은 debug,info,error, warn 입니다.
  • <AppSync > - AppSync는 Argo CD 애플리케이션의 동기화 빈도를 제어하는 데 사용됩니다.
  • <sharding.enabled > - Argo CD 애플리케이션 컨트롤러 구성 요소에서 샤딩을 활성화합니다. 이 속성은 컨트롤러 구성 요소의 메모리 부족을 완화하기 위해 많은 수의 클러스터를 관리하는 데 사용됩니다.
  • <sharding.replicas > - Argo CD 애플리케이션 컨트롤러의 분할을 지원하는 데 사용할 복제본 수입니다.
  • < env> - 애플리케이션 컨트롤러 워크로드에 설정할 환경입니다.

DisableAdmin

기본 제공 admin 사용자를 비활성화합니다.

false

 

GATrackingID

Google Analytics 추적 ID를 사용합니다.

<empty>

 

GAAnonymizeusers

Google 분석으로 전송된 해시된 사용자 이름을 활성화합니다.

false

 

HA

높은 가용성 옵션.

<Object>

  • <enabled > - Argo CD에 대해 전역적으로 고가용성 지원을 제공합니다.
  • <RedisProxyImage > - Redis HAProxy 컨테이너 이미지. 이렇게 하면 ARGOCD_REDIS_HA_PROXY_IMAGE 환경 변수가 재정의됩니다.
  • <RedisProxyVersion > - Redis HAProxy 컨테이너 이미지에 사용할 태그입니다.

HelpChatURL

채팅 도움말을 가져오기 위한 URL(일반적으로 지원을 위한 Slack 채널임).

https://mycorp.slack.com/argo-cd

 

HelpChatText

채팅 도움말을 가져오기 위해 텍스트 상자에 표시되는 텍스트입니다.

지금 채팅!

 

Image

모든 Argo CD 구성 요소의 컨테이너 이미지입니다. 이렇게 하면 ARGOCD_IMAGE 환경 변수가 재정의됩니다.

argoproj/argocd

 

Ingress

인그레스 구성 옵션.

<Object>

 

InitialRepositories

클러스터 생성 시 사용할 Argo CD를 구성하는 초기 Git 리포지토리입니다.

<empty>

 

알림

알림 컨트롤러 구성 옵션.

<Object>

  • < enabled > - notifications-controller를 시작하기 위한 토글입니다.
  • <image> - 모든 Argo CD 구성 요소의 컨테이너 이미지입니다. 이렇게 하면 ARGOCD_IMAGE 환경 변수가 재정의됩니다.
  • < version > - 알림 컨테이너 이미지와 함께 사용할 태그입니다.
  • < resources > - 컨테이너 컴퓨팅 리소스입니다.
  • &lt ;loglevel> - Argo CD 애플리케이션 컨트롤러 구성 요소에서 사용하는 로그 수준입니다. 유효한 옵션은 debug,info,error, warn 입니다.

RepositoryCredentials

클러스터 생성 시 사용할 Argo CD를 구성하기 위한 Git 리포지토리 인증 정보 템플릿입니다.

<empty>

 

InitialSSHKnownHosts

Argo CD의 초기 SSH 알려진 호스트는 클러스터 생성 시 사용할 수 있습니다.

<default_Argo_CD_Known_Hosts>

 

KustomizeBuildOptions

kustomize 빌드와 함께 사용할 빌드 옵션 및 매개변수입니다.

<empty>

 

OIDCConfig

OIDC 구성의 대안으로 Dex입니다.

<empty>

 

nodePlacement

nodeSelector허용 오차 를 추가합니다.

<empty>

 

Prometheus

Prometheus 구성 옵션.

<Object>

  • <enabled > - Argo CD에 대해 전역적으로 Prometheus를 지원합니다.
  • < host > - Ingress 또는 Route 리소스에 사용할 호스트 이름입니다.
  • & lt;Ingress > - Prometheus에 대한 집계 Ingress입니다.
  • & lt;route > - 경로 구성 옵션입니다.
  • < size > - Prometheus StatefulSet 의 복제본 수입니다.

RBAC

RBAC 구성 옵션.

<Object>

  • < DefaultPolicy > - argocd-rbac-cm 구성 맵의 policy.default 속성입니다. API 요청을 승인할 때 Argo CD가 다시 대체되는 기본 역할의 이름입니다.
  • &lt ; policy> - argocd-rbac-cm 구성 맵의 policy.csv 속성입니다. 사용자 정의 RBAC 정책 및 역할 정의가 포함된 CSV 데이터입니다.
  • < scopes > - argocd-rbac-cm 구성 맵의 scopes 속성입니다. RBAC 적용 중에 검사할 OIDC 범위(하위 범위에 추가)를 제어합니다.

Redis

Redis 구성 옵션.

<Object>

  • <AutoTLS > - 공급자를 사용하여 Redis 서버의 TLS 인증서( openshift 중 하나)를 생성합니다. 현재 OpenShift Container Platform에서만 사용할 수 있습니다.
  • <DisableTLSVerification > - 엄격한 TLS 검증을 사용하여 Redis 서버에 액세스해야 하는지 여부를 정의합니다.
  • &lt ;image > - Redis의 컨테이너 이미지입니다. 이렇게 하면 ARGOCD_REDIS_IMAGE 환경 변수가 재정의됩니다.
  • < resources > - 컨테이너 컴퓨팅 리소스입니다.
  • < version > - Redis 컨테이너 이미지와 함께 사용할 태그입니다.

ResourceCustomizations

리소스 동작을 사용자 정의합니다.

<empty>

 

ResourceExclusions

리소스 그룹의 전체 클래스를 완전히 무시합니다.

<empty>

 

resourceInclusions

적용되는 리소스 그룹/종류를 구성할 구성입니다.

<empty>

 

서버

Argo CD 서버 구성 옵션.

<Object>

  • & lt;autoscale& gt; - 서버 자동 스케일링 구성 옵션.
  • <ExtraCommandArgs > - Operator가 설정한 기존 인수에 추가된 인수 목록입니다.
  • <GRPC > - GRPC 구성 옵션
  • < host > - Ingress 또는 Route 리소스에 사용되는 호스트 이름입니다.
  • <Ingress > - Argo CD 서버 구성 요소에 대한 Ingress 구성입니다.
  • <insecure > - Argo CD 서버의 비보안 플래그를 집계합니다.
  • < resources > - 컨테이너 컴퓨팅 리소스입니다.
  • &lt ; replicas> - Argo CD 서버의 복제본 수입니다. 0 보다 크거나 같아야 합니다. Autoscale 이 활성화되면 Replicas 가 무시됩니다.
  • & lt;route > - 경로 구성 옵션입니다.
  • <service .Type > - 서비스 리소스에 사용되는 ServiceType 입니다.
  • &lt ;loglevel> - Argo CD Server 구성 요소에서 사용할 로그 수준입니다. 유효한 옵션은 debug,info,error, warn 입니다.
  • < LogFormat > - Argo CD 애플리케이션 컨트롤러 구성 요소에서 사용하는 로그 형식입니다. 유효한 옵션은 text 또는 json 입니다.
  • < env> - 서버 워크로드에 설정할 환경입니다.

SSO

Single Sign-On 옵션

<Object>

  • &lt ; image> - Keycloak의 컨테이너 이미지입니다. 이렇게 하면 ARGOCD_KEYCLOAK_IMAGE 환경 변수가 재정의됩니다.
  • <Keycloak > - Keycloak SSO 공급자에 대한 구성 옵션입니다.
  • <DEX& gt; - Dex SSO 공급자에 대한 구성 옵션입니다.
  • <provider> - Single Sign-on을 구성하는 데 사용되는 공급자의 이름입니다. 현재 지원되는 옵션은 Dex 및 Keycloak입니다.
  • < resources > - 컨테이너 컴퓨팅 리소스입니다.
  • <VerifyTLS > - Keycloak 서비스와 통신할 때 엄격한 TLS 검사를 적용할지 여부입니다.
  • &lt ; version> - Keycloak 컨테이너 이미지와 함께 사용할 태그입니다.

StatusBadgeEnabled

애플리케이션 상태 배지를 활성화합니다.

true

 

TLS

TLS 구성 옵션.

<Object>

  • <CA.ConfigMapName > - CA 인증서가 포함된 ConfigMap 의 이름입니다.
  • < CA.SecretName > - CA 인증서 및 키가 포함된 시크릿의 이름입니다.
  • <InitialCerts > - HTTPS를 통해 Git 리포지토리를 연결하기 위한 argocd-tls-certs-cm 구성 맵의 초기 인증서 세트입니다.

UserAnonyousEnabled

익명 사용자 액세스를 활성화합니다.

true

 

버전

모든 Argo CD 구성 요소에 대해 컨테이너 이미지와 함께 사용할 태그입니다.

최신 Argo CD 버전

 

배너

UI 배너 메시지를 추가합니다.

<Object>

  • <banner .Content > - 배너 메시지 콘텐츠( banner가 표시되는 경우 필수)입니다.
  • <banner.URL.SecretName > - 배너 메시지 링크 URL(선택 사항)입니다.
맨 위로 이동
Red Hat logoGithubredditYoutubeTwitter

자세한 정보

평가판, 구매 및 판매

커뮤니티

Red Hat 문서 정보

Red Hat을 사용하는 고객은 신뢰할 수 있는 콘텐츠가 포함된 제품과 서비스를 통해 혁신하고 목표를 달성할 수 있습니다. 최신 업데이트를 확인하세요.

보다 포괄적 수용을 위한 오픈 소스 용어 교체

Red Hat은 코드, 문서, 웹 속성에서 문제가 있는 언어를 교체하기 위해 최선을 다하고 있습니다. 자세한 내용은 다음을 참조하세요.Red Hat 블로그.

Red Hat 소개

Red Hat은 기업이 핵심 데이터 센터에서 네트워크 에지에 이르기까지 플랫폼과 환경 전반에서 더 쉽게 작업할 수 있도록 강화된 솔루션을 제공합니다.

Theme

© 2025 Red Hat